AMOS BASIC Programming Language
   HOME
*





AMOS BASIC Programming Language
AMOS BASIC is a dialect of the BASIC programming language for the Amiga computer. Following on from the successful STOS BASIC for the Atari ST, AMOS BASIC was written for the Amiga by François Lionet with Constantin Sotiropoulos and published by Europress Software in 1990. History AMOS competed on the Amiga platform with Acid Software's Blitz BASIC. Both BASICs differed from other dialects on different platforms, in that they allowed the easy creation of fairly demanding multimedia software, with full structured code and many high-level functions to load images, animations, sounds and display them in various ways. The original AMOS was a BASIC interpreter which, whilst working fine, suffered the same disadvantages of any language being run interpretively. By all accounts, AMOS was extremely fast among interpreted languages, being speedy enough that an extension called AMOS 3D could produce playable 3D games even on plain 7 MHz 68000 Amigas. Later, an AMOS compiler was de 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Imperative Programming
In computer science, imperative programming is a programming paradigm of software that uses statements that change a program's state. In much the same way that the imperative mood in natural languages expresses commands, an imperative program consists of commands for the computer to perform. Imperative programming focuses on describing ''how'' a program operates step by step, rather than on high-level descriptions of its expected results. The term is often used in contrast to declarative programming, which focuses on ''what'' the program should accomplish without specifying all the details of ''how'' the program should achieve the result. Imperative and procedural programming Procedural programming is a type of imperative programming in which the program is built from one or more procedures (also termed subroutines or functions). The terms are often used as synonyms, but the use of procedures has a dramatic effect on how imperative programs appear and how they are constructed 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

MC68000
The Motorola 68000 (sometimes shortened to Motorola 68k or m68k and usually pronounced "sixty-eight-thousand") is a 16/32-bit complex instruction set computer (CISC) microprocessor, introduced in 1979 by Motorola Semiconductor Products Sector. The design implements a 32-bit instruction set, with 32-bit registers and a 16-bit internal data bus. The address bus is 24 bits and does not use memory segmentation, which made it easier to program for. Internally, it uses a 16-bit data arithmetic logic unit (ALU) and two more 16-bit ALUs used mostly for addresses, and has a 16-bit external data bus. For this reason, Motorola termed it a 16/32-bit processor. As one of the first widely available processors with a 32-bit instruction set, and running at relatively high speeds for the era, the 68k was a popular design through the 1980s. It was widely used in a new generation of personal computers with graphical user interfaces, including the Macintosh 128K, Amiga, Atari ST, and X68000. The 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Ultimate Domain
''Ultimate Domain'', known as ''Genesia'' in Europe, is a computer game developed by Microïds and published by Mindscape initially on the Commodore Amiga in 1993 and then ported for the IBM PC in 1994. The original Amiga version is known to be one of the few commercial games developed in AMOS Basic. In 2011, an iPad version was released. A follow-up to ''Ultimate Domain'' named ''Genesia Legacy'' was scheduled to be released in 2015. Plot ''Ultimate Domain'' starts in the 17th century in the colonies of the new world, where the player has four settlers and a few raw materials. The settlers take jobs such as woodcutter, architect, and specialist; woodcutters turn trees into logs, architects use wood, stone, and metal to make various kinds of buildings, and specialists make goods for selling once a shop is built. The settlers may also search for "The Seven Jewels of Genesia". Reception ''Computer Gaming World'' rated ''Ultimate Domain'' one star out of five. Describing it as a 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Before The War
Before is the opposite of after, and may refer to: * ''Before'' (Gold Panda EP), 2009 * ''Before'' (James Blake EP), 2020 * "Before" (song), a 1996 song by the Pet Shop Boys * "Before", a song by the Empire of the Sun from '' Two Vines'' * "Before", a song by Anastacia from '' Evolution'' * "Before" (short story) by Gael Baudino * The Before film trilogy by Richard Linklater ** '' Before Sunrise'', 1995 ** '' Before Sunset'', 2004 ** ''Before Midnight'' (2013 film) See also * Before Christ (BC), an epoch used in dating years prior to the estimated birth of Jesus * Before Common Era (BCE), an alternative naming of the traditional calendar era primarily used in academic circles * Before Present (BP), a timescale used mainly in geology * * {{Disambiguation 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Vulcan Software
Vulcan Software was an independent computer games company founded in 1994 in the UK. Vulcan started creating software for the Amiga computer systems. Its first commercial game was ''Valhalla and the Lord of Infinity'', which was notable for being the first ever Amiga speech adventure game. In January 1999, Vulcan Software started development for PC computer systems. The Director of Vulcan Software is Paul Carrington. In 2007, Vulcan announced a partnership with Amiga, Inc Amiga, Inc. is a company that used to hold some trademarks and other assets associated with the Amiga personal computer (originally developed by Amiga Corporation). Early years In the early 1980s Jay Miner, along with other Atari, Inc. staffe ... to develop older Amiga games for PCs and other devices. Games *''Valhalla and the Lord of Infinity'' *'' Valhalla: Before the War'' *''Valhalla and the Fortress of Eve'' *''Timekeepers'' *''JetPilot'' *''Burnout'' *''Tiny Troops'' *''Hillsea Lido'' *''Genetic Sp 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Scorched Tanks
''Scorched Tanks'' is an artillery style game released for the Amiga platform in 1994. The game is inspired by the MS-DOS game ''Scorched Earth'' (1991). Gameplay Between two and four human and computer-controlled opponents each control one stationary tank in a two-dimensional playfield of randomly generated mountainous terrain. The aim of the game is to destroy the other tanks by shooting, utilizing indirect fire. The game has 70 weapons and 13 types of shield, ranging from simple to the elaborate. Players purchase equipment before each round, and bonus cash is awarded for dealing damage to opponents. Weapons include the Liquid Nitrogen, which fills like a liquid and deals damage to tanks before it evaporates, Crimson Flood, which triggers a series of explosions that cover terrain and deals damage to tanks in the path of the explosions, Crazy 8s, which bounces unpredictably around the target, Mega Nuke, which obliterates any tanks in its blast radius, and the Grab Bag, which 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Miggybyte
''Miggybyte'' was a free disk-based magazine for the Amiga range of computers, published by Pickled Fish Software and edited by Ben Gaunt. From 1995 to 1997 twelve issues were published all being on a single floppy disk only. The magazine was inspired by ''Grapevine'', the scene-based disk magazine also for the Amiga range of computers, but ''Miggybyte'' was not a scene publication. The publication focused on news about the Amiga, software, games and entertainment. The entertainment section proved to be a main stay of the publication and consisting of jokes and stories from readers. There was even a small classified section and BBS section where many Sysops from around the UK (thought there were a few from the USA too) would publicise their boards. The interface consisted of two sections, the top part containing the text and in latter version graphics, the bottom the control interface (GUI). The engine behind the publication was called MultiMedia Magazine Creator (MMMC) and wa 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


JavaScript
JavaScript (), often abbreviated as JS, is a programming language that is one of the core technologies of the World Wide Web, alongside HTML and CSS. As of 2022, 98% of Website, websites use JavaScript on the Client (computing), client side for Web page, webpage behavior, often incorporating third-party Library (computing), libraries. All major Web browser, web browsers have a dedicated JavaScript engine to execute the Source code, code on User (computing), users' devices. JavaScript is a High-level programming language, high-level, often Just-in-time compilation, just-in-time compiled language that conforms to the ECMAScript standard. It has dynamic typing, Prototype-based programming, prototype-based object-oriented programming, object-orientation, and first-class functions. It is Programming paradigm, multi-paradigm, supporting Event-driven programming, event-driven, functional programming, functional, and imperative programming, imperative programming paradigm, programmin 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Clickteam
Clickteam is a French software development company based in Boulogne-Billancourt, Hauts-de-Seine. Founded by Francis Poulain, François Lionet and Yves Lamoureux, Clickteam is best known for the creation of Clickteam Fusion, a script-free programming tool that allows users to create video games or other interactive software using a highly advanced event system. History Before co-founding Clickteam, François Lionet was the programmer of STOS BASIC, a programming language released in 1988 for the Atari ST, and AMOS BASIC, a more advanced programming language released in 1990 for the Commodore Amiga. Both of these have since been released in open-source form on the Clickteam corporate website. Yves Lamoureux was also a successful game developer prior to co-founding Clickteam, working with multiple companies on games. Clickteam's debut software was ''Klik & Play'', released in 1994 as commercial, proprietary software; this marked the team's first successful software relea 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Source Code
In computing, source code, or simply code, is any collection of code, with or without comments, written using a human-readable programming language, usually as plain text. The source code of a program is specially designed to facilitate the work of computer programmers, who specify the actions to be performed by a computer mostly by writing source code. The source code is often transformed by an assembler or compiler into binary machine code that can be executed by the computer. The machine code is then available for execution at a later time. Most application software is distributed in a form that includes only executable files. If the source code were included it would be useful to a user, programmer or a system administrator, any of whom might wish to study or modify the program. Alternatively, depending on the technology being used, source code may be interpreted and executed directly. Definitions Richard Stallman's definition, formulated in his 1989 seminal li 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Video Game
Video games, also known as computer games, are electronic games that involves interaction with a user interface or input device such as a joystick, controller, keyboard, or motion sensing device to generate visual feedback. This feedback mostly commonly is shown on a video display device, such as a TV set, monitor, touchscreen, or virtual reality headset. Some computer games do not always depend on a graphics display, for example text adventure games and computer chess can be played through teletype printers. Video games are often augmented with audio feedback delivered through speakers or headphones, and sometimes with other types of feedback, including haptic technology. Video games are defined based on their platform, which include arcade video games, console games, and personal computer (PC) games. More recently, the industry has expanded onto mobile gaming through smartphones and tablet computers, virtual and augmented reality systems, and remote c 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Control Flow
In computer science, control flow (or flow of control) is the order in which individual statements, instructions or function calls of an imperative program are executed or evaluated. The emphasis on explicit control flow distinguishes an ''imperative programming'' language from a '' declarative programming'' language. Within an imperative programming language, a ''control flow statement'' is a statement that results in a choice being made as to which of two or more paths to follow. For non-strict functional languages, functions and language constructs exist to achieve the same result, but they are usually not termed control flow statements. A set of statements is in turn generally structured as a block, which in addition to grouping, also defines a lexical scope. Interrupts and signals are low-level mechanisms that can alter the flow of control in a way similar to a subroutine, but usually occur as a response to some external stimulus or event (that can occur asynchronously), 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]